Rocket Lab has successfully launched a rocket into space this afternoon following a series of weather-related delays.
The mission was carried out from the Kiwi-US aerospace manufacturer's launch pad in the Māhia Peninsula, in Wairoa, at 12.27pm today.
The test, involving Rocket Lab's Risk Reduction Deployment Demonstration (DARPA R3D2) spacecraft, was carried out in order to test an experimental expandable antenna for the US Department of Defence's experimental technology division, the Defence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A).
''There are a lot of dual technologies that can be used in space and this antenna is a great example. While it has a military communication application, there is equal amount of interest in it being used for commercial purposes as well," Rocket Lab CEO Peter Beck said.
